Market Size:

The Ablation Devices Market size is estimated to reach over USD 18,418.79 Million by 2031 from a value of USD 9,058.00 Million in 2023, growing at a CAGR of 9.4% from 2024 to 2031.

Definition of Market:

The Ablation Devices Market encompasses the production, distribution, and utilization of medical devices designed to ablate, or remove, unwanted tissue. Ablation is a minimally invasive procedure that uses energy sources to destroy targeted cells, offering a less invasive alternative to traditional surgery. Key components within this market include a diverse range of devices such as radiofrequency ablation (RFA) systems, cryoablation devices, microwave ablation (MWA) systems, and pulsed-field ablation (PFA) technologies.

Key terms related to this market are:

* **Ablation:** The process of removing or destroying tissue using energy sources.

* **Radiofrequency Ablation (RFA):** A technique that uses radiofrequency energy to generate heat and destroy targeted tissue.

* **Cryoablation:** A method that employs extreme cold to freeze and destroy abnormal tissue.

* **Microwave Ablation (MWA):** A process that utilizes microwave energy to heat and ablate tissue.

* **Pulsed-Field Ablation (PFA):** A novel technique that uses short, high-voltage electrical pulses to selectively ablate targeted cells without damaging surrounding tissue.

* **Catheter Ablation:** A minimally invasive procedure where a catheter is inserted into a blood vessel and guided to the heart to ablate tissue causing arrhythmias.

* **Lesion:** The area of tissue that has been ablated or destroyed.

Market Challenges:

The Ablation Devices Market faces several significant challenges that could impede its growth trajectory. One of the primary challenges is the high initial cost associated with these devices and the necessary infrastructure. Many healthcare facilities, particularly in developing countries, may find it difficult to justify the capital expenditure required to adopt these advanced technologies. This cost barrier is further compounded by the ongoing need for specialized training and maintenance, which adds to the overall financial burden.

Another significant challenge is the complexity of ablation procedures. While they are considered minimally invasive, these procedures require a high degree of skill and expertise. The learning curve for healthcare professionals can be steep, and inadequate training may lead to suboptimal outcomes or even complications. Ensuring that healthcare providers receive comprehensive and ongoing training is crucial, but it also presents a logistical and financial challenge.

Furthermore, regulatory hurdles and the time-consuming approval processes can delay the introduction of innovative ablation devices to the market. Stringent regulatory requirements are essential to ensure patient safety and efficacy, but they can also create a bottleneck that slows down the adoption of new technologies. Streamlining the regulatory process without compromising safety is a critical challenge for the industry.

Competition from alternative treatment modalities also poses a challenge. Traditional surgical procedures and pharmaceutical interventions remain viable options for many of the conditions that ablation devices are used to treat. To gain market share, ablation device manufacturers must demonstrate the clear advantages of their technologies in terms of clinical outcomes, patient satisfaction, and cost-effectiveness.

Finally, the need for continuous innovation presents a constant challenge. The medical device industry is characterized by rapid technological advancements, and ablation device manufacturers must continually invest in research and development to stay ahead of the curve. Failure to innovate and adapt to changing market needs could result in obsolescence and loss of market share. Balancing the need for innovation with the practical considerations of cost, regulatory compliance, and clinical adoption is a key challenge for the industry.
